City to Host Climate Adaption Event
Posted on 10/18/2022

Free event to feature four guest speakers, local expertise and insights

The City of Charlottetown is hosting a free panel discussion event on climate adaptation as part of the City’s Resilient Homes, Parks and People program. Community members are invited to attend in-person and hear presentations from four guest speakers followed by a Q&A discussion.

About the Event:

Date: Tuesday, October 25, 2022
Time: 7:00 p.m. to 8:30 p.m.
Location: PEI Farm Centre, 420 University Av, Charlottetown, PE C1A 2Y9
Details: Climate adaptation panel discussion and Q&A

Speakers and Topics:

  • Hope Parnham, Adaptation Policy Advisor with the PEI Department of Environment, Energy and Climate Action
    • Topic: Climate change risks require all-hands on deck
  • Dr. Xiuquan (Xander) Wang, Associate Professor, School of Climate Change and Adaptation and Director, Climate Smart Lab, Canadian Centre for Climate Change and Adaptation, UPEI
    • Topic: Flood prediction, along with monitoring results from Hurricane Fiona
  • Tara Callaghan, Landscape Architect, Haute Nature Design
    • Topic: Reintegrating our role with nature
  • Cheryl Evans, Director, Flood and Wildfire Resilience, Intact Centre on Climate Adaptation, University of Waterloo
    • Topic: Be storm ready! Home and garden flood protection tips for the fall
